Launchpad search stops working

Anyone else seen this bug? After working on the Mac for sometime I open Launchpad, type something and nothing happens. Log out / restart fixes it temporarily, till it happens again.

Launchpad is related to the dock.


Try doing a Dock restart using the following Terminal command:


killall Dock


Log out/in and test. If that doesnt work, you need to look in your user Library/Applications Support/Dock for the .db. Use the Finder “Go To Folder” command. Enter ~/ Library/Applications Support/Dock. Move the .db to your desktop.


Then try a dock reset.


Applications/Utilities/Terminal enter the command


killall Dock


Log out/in test. If it works okay, delete the .db from the desktop.


If the Dock is the same, return the .db to where you got them from, overwriting the newer ones.
